About Laura Bernard

Laura Bernard is a scholar working on Astronomy and Astrophysics, Nuclear and High Energy Physics, Oceanography, Atomic and Molecular Physics, and Optics and Ocean Engineering, having authored 24 papers that have together received 824 indexed citations. Recurring topics across this work include Cosmology and Gravitation Theories (17 papers), Pulsars and Gravitational Waves Research (15 papers), Black Holes and Theoretical Physics (10 papers), Gamma-ray bursts and supernovae (7 papers), Advanced Differential Geometry Research (3 papers), Dark Matter and Cosmic Phenomena (3 papers), Astrophysical Phenomena and Observations (3 papers) and Geophysics and Gravity Measurements (2 papers). The work is most often cited by research in Astronomy and Astrophysics (781 citations), Nuclear and High Energy Physics (456 citations), Oceanography (83 citations), Geophysics (70 citations) and Statistical and Nonlinear Physics (43 citations). Laura Bernard has collaborated with scholars based in France, Portugal and Canada. Frequent co-authors include Luc Blanchet, Guillaume Faye, S. Marsat, A. Bohé, Tanguy Marchand, Mikael von Strauss, Cédric Deffayet, Luis Lehner, Raimon Luna and Vítor Cardoso. Their work appears in journals such as Physical review. D, Nuclear Physics B, Journal of Cosmology and Astroparticle Physics, International Journal of Modern Physics Conference Series and Physical review. D. Particles, fields, gravitation, and cosmology.
